Prasad K.D.V. Yaragada is a researcher whose work has made meaningful contributions to the field of welding engineering, with a particular focus on Gas Metal Arc (GMA) welding processes and process optimization. His research centers on understanding and improving weld quality through rigorous statistical analysis, most notably sensitivity analysis and factorial design methods. His most influential work, published in 2003, applies factorial design methodology to identify and quantify the effects of critical process parameters on GMA welding outcomes, a contribution that has garnered an impressive 170 citations and established itself as a key reference for engineers and researchers seeking to optimize welding processes. Complementing this, his parallel investigation into robotic GMA welding systems extended these analytical frameworks to automated manufacturing environments, accumulating an additional 40 citations.
